The Ford Jubilee has three areas for fluid. The transmission has a filler cap near the gear shift. The hydraulic fluid has a filler cap under the edge of the seat and the differential has a filler cap behind the seat. There is a small dipstick on the right hand side to determine hydraulic fluid level.

The book says the intire hydraulic system holds 36 gallons and the tank holds 28 gallons. This is from the manual of a 1998 555E I purchased.
Hydraulic oil sight gauge and filler cap are located on back side of tractor below the big red warning triangle. Sight gauge is a small round window. Do not run without hydraulic fluid, it services the transmission too !!
